Transaction 2f70296745959410a0e95909ad5c2fa412b69311d03870e92f1958b20e8e6882
1 Input
2 Outputs
- 2f70296745959410a0e95909ad5c2fa412b69311d03870e92f1958b20e8e6882:0
- 2f70296745959410a0e95909ad5c2fa412b69311d03870e92f1958b20e8e6882:1
value 64415256
address 1P9sUiLeHwua9danopN5xG35W5iU3HVXKc
value 175428
address 1GHWWo3eCKpBrfpkTdgS3K7o6Lwh55ExG8